The Mona Lisa is located at the Louvre Museum in Paris, France. It has been on display there since 1797 and is usually exhibited in the Salle des États, the Louvre's largest room, which can accommodate the many visitors who come to see it
. Occasionally, the painting has been temporarily moved within the Louvre for renovations or special circumstances, such as in 2019 when it was temporarily displayed in the Galerie Médicis during renovations of its usual room
. However, it remains part of the Louvre's permanent collection and is not exhibited outside the museum due to its fragility and immense value
